On Tuesday 20 April 2021, I attended an emergency meeting with the Leader of the Opposition following the announcement of the European Super League. We discussed what we could do to oppose the Super League with Malcolm Clarke, Chair of the Football Supporters Association.

I appeared on BBC Politics Midlands on Sunday 18 April 2021. We discussed the funeral of HRH Prince Phillip, vaccine passports and the upcoming local elections. You can watch the episode on iPlayer here: BBC iPlayer - Politics Midlands - 18/04/2021.
